阳泉一矿选煤厂主洗系统改造方案研究

    Study on renovation scheme of main separation system at No.1 Yangquan Mine Coal Preparation Plant

    • 摘要: 针对阳泉一矿选煤厂产品硫分偏高、产品竞争力较弱的问题,拟对现有工艺流程进行改造,具体措施为:用无压给料三产品重介旋流器代替末煤跳汰系统;降低原煤入洗粒度上限至50 mm;改进煤泥水系统,设置末精煤离心机和煤泥离心机。预计改造后,每年可多回收末精煤1.40~1.70 Mt,增加利润约8 000万元,并提高了产品质量,可将末精煤硫分控制在1.75%以内。

       

      Abstract: Considerably high sulfur of coal product is the problem confronted by No. 1 Yangquan Mine Coal Preparation Plant,which has had the product in a weak competitive position. To tackle this problem,a study on renovation scheme is made on the existing coal washing circuit through adding small clean coal centrifuge and coal slime centrifuge in coal slurry treatment process,as well as the use of gravity-fed 3-product dense medium cyclone instead of small coal jigging system,leading to top size of raw coal to be washed up to 50 mm. It is expected after the renovation that there will be an increase of the recovery of the clean coal by 14-17 million tons each year,an increase of profits by CNY 80 million or so,as well as an enhancement of both product quality and sulfur of clean coal controlled within 1. 75 percentage points.
